Objectives:
This programme is designed in such a way so as to impart training in the recent advancements and modern trends in the field of Software Engineering.
Duration: Four Semesters
The candidate shall complete the programme within a period of seven years from the year of admission.
Eligibility:
1.
A pass in any degree with Maths at Higher Secondary level or equivalent.
2.
Candidates who have not studied Maths at +2 level should undergo a bridge programme for a week.

| Project
work |
|
The Students are expected to do a project work, in an assigned topic under the supervision of an approved guide individually during the final semester. |
